Derrick Roland & Texas A&M
If you get the opportunity send out your best wishes & prayers to Derrick Roland & the Texas A&M Aggies.
On Tuesday Night during the Texas A&M-University of Washington Game in Seattle, during the 2nd half of the game senior Derrick Roland went for an easy rebound & on his way down he broke his Tibia & Fibula in his right leg. The game was suspended for abpout 10 minutes while he was attended to & taken via ambulance to Harborview Medical Center. Later that evening he went through a 75-minute surgery to insert pins & rods to mend his leg. He's doing better now, but his future is basketball right now is uncertain. He's expected to be released from Harborview today & be flown back down to Texas via a chartered medical flight.
